#3b5827 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3b5827 is composed of 23.1% red, 34.5% green and 15.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.7%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 95.5 degrees, a saturation of 38.6% and a lightness of 24.9%. #3b5827 color hex could be obtained by blending #76b04e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#3b5827 color description : Very dark desaturated green.
#3b5827 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3b5827 has RGB values of R:59, G:88, B:39 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0, Y:0.56,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 3889191.
